Welcome to Cabin 48 at Arroyo Seco Resort, a scenic 115-acre riverfront community at the base of Los Padres National Forest with the Arroyo Seco River winding through it. Residents enjoy access to community beaches, hiking trails, and stunning mountain landscapes throughout the resort. This 2-bedroom, 1-bath cabin offers approximately 950 sq ft and sits in a sought-after location between the popular Campbell's Rock and Big Beach areas so you can hike and walk to beloved swimming holes just minutes away. The lot features two driveways with plenty of parking, a built-in BBQ, an 80sqft TuffShed and a concrete patio area with oak trees that provide welcome shade for outdoor gatherings. The property boasts a great layout and is perfectly positioned for the quintessential river lifestyle; with some TLC, this cabin can be restored to its full glory. A rare opportunity to own in one of the Central Coast's most picturesque river communities.
